Just read some of the replies to your post and you will understand. In reality, a private school has to "recruit" every student at their school. They do it by providing things that parents don't perceive that they can get at the public school they are zoned for or at another private school (better academics or athletics, safer environment, tradition, etc. and remember I typed PERCEIVE). You don't think they recruit arts / theater students? Of course they do - they spend big $ for their new art and theater buildings and that lures parents who have that orientation. If a parent doesn't believe their child would be better off at that school they would not send them there - period. My kids are at a public high school and they both used to be at a private school. I believe they are getting just as good an education than they were and even better in some areas. Unless there is proof that they are actually paying off the parents to send their children to a school, this whole thing is just a pointless conversation. Of course I am contributing this epistle to it - sorry! Put reasonable rules in place and try to make sure they are being followed.
